Muscari 'Mount Hood'
Muscari aucheri
'Mount Hood'
Muscari aucheri 'Mount Hood' is a plant characterized by beautiful blue flowers and elegant white tips. The following is information regarding this plant's growth characteristics, propagation methods, cultivation methods, garden uses, and major pests and diseases, as well as control methods. Growth Characteristics - Plant Size: Grows to a height of approximately 15–20 cm. - Flowering Season: Blooms mainly in the spring. The typical flowering period is between March and May. - Sunlight Requirements: Prefers partial shade to full sun conditions. - Soil Conditions: Likes well-drained soil, and slightly acidic soil is suitable. Propagation Methods - Bulb Division: Bulbs can be separated and propagated in the autumn. Divided bulbs must be planted immediately. - Seed Sowing: Propagation is also possible via seeds, but it requires significant time and care. Cultivation Methods - Planting: It is best to plant in the autumn. Plant the bulbs deep in the soil so that the tips are not visible. - Watering: There is no need to water excessively during the summer. In particular, overwatering should be avoided. - Fertilizer: It is recommended to apply an appropriate amount of fertilizer during the early growth stage and before flowering. Uses in the Garden - Muscari is excellent for use as a border plant; its beauty can be maximized, especially when planted in clusters along the edges of a lawn. - It can also create a stunning effect when planted in flowerbeds or pots, and can be combined with other spring flowers to create a spectacular flower garden. Important Pests and Control Methods - Diseases: Fungal diseases may appear on the leaves. In this case, special care must be taken during periods of heavy rain; infected parts should be removed immediately, and a fungicide should be applied. - Pests: Aphids are a common problem. In this case, they can be controlled using soapy water or appropriate commercial insecticides. Muscari 'Mount Hood' is a relatively easy-to-care-for plant, making it an attractive choice for beginners to grow.
